Regular Season Round 2: Stevnsgade - Lemvig 84-82

Date: October 4, 2014
The most crucial game of the last round was a loss of Lemvig (1-1) on the court of Stevnsgade. Visitors were edged by Stevnsgade 84-82. It looked good early as Lemvig took an 2-point lead at the end of first quarter. But then Stevnsgade had a 23-18 second period charge getting the lead and Lemvig was not able to take back game control losing it eventually 82-84. Stevnsgade forced 20 Lemvig turnovers. Swingman Ida Pretzmann (178-90, college: TCU) orchestrated the victory by scoring 24 points, 6 rebounds and 4 assists. American forward Jordan Sullivan (188-91, college: Montana) contributed with 22 points and 8 rebounds for the winners. U.S. Virgin Islands-American swingman Natalie Day (182-90, college: Portland) replied with a double-double by scoring 33 points (!!!) and 10 rebounds (was perfect 14-for-14 from the free throw line !!!) and American guard Joanna Miller (173-91, college: Grambling St.) added 16 points in the effort for Lemvig. Stevnsgade will play against SISU in Copenhagen in the next round and it will be for sure the game of the week. Lemvig will have a break next round.
